Renal Timing is an educational website dedicated to understanding how blood pressure timing, circadian rhythm, and physiology influence kidney health. Rather than focusing solely on clinic readings or target numbers, the platform explains blood pressure as a continuous 24-hour exposure that affects kidneys differently depending on when it occurs. Many harmful patterns—such as early-morning surges, nighttime non-dipping, stress-related spikes, and mistimed treatment—often go unnoticed until chronic kidney disease (CKD) has already progressed. Renal Timing exists to make these invisible patterns visible. Grounded in physiology and informed by lived experience, the site translates complex concepts into clear, accessible education for patients, families, clinicians, and health advocates. Its goal is not to replace medical care, but to support earlier awareness, better questions, and more precise conversations about blood pressure and kidney protection.
